享元模式flyweight

学习笔记,原文链接 https://refactoringguru.cn/design-patterns/flyweight

通过共享多个对象所共有的相同状态, 让你能在有限的内存容量中载入更多对象。享元会将不同对象的相同数据进行缓存以节省内存。


factory里面treeType共用了

相关推荐
yaaakaaang2 天前
十一、享元模式
java·享元模式
无籽西瓜a5 天前
【西瓜带你学设计模式 | 第十四期 - 享元模式】享元模式 —— 内外状态分离与对象共享实现、优缺点与适用场景
java·设计模式·软件工程·享元模式
砍光二叉树16 天前
【设计模式】结构型-享元模式
设计模式·享元模式
青春易逝丶25 天前
享元模式
享元模式
Chasing__Dreams1 个月前
python--设计模式--13.1--结构性--享元模式
python·设计模式·享元模式
sg_knight1 个月前
设计模式实战:享元模式(Flyweight)
python·设计模式·享元模式·flyweight
C++chaofan1 个月前
JUC 并发编程:不可变对象、享元模式与自定义连接池 学习笔记
java·享元模式·并发编程·连接池·juc·不可变对象
资深web全栈开发2 个月前
设计模式之享元模式 (Flyweight Pattern)
设计模式·享元模式
YigAin2 个月前
Unity23种设计模式之 享元模式
设计模式·享元模式
会员果汁3 个月前
22.设计模式-享元模式(Flyweight)
设计模式·哈希算法·享元模式